>While I can view a vcd in the windows without any hitch, when I try do
>the same thing under linux (with GTV), I get the message that
>Input/Output error and it can not read data. I mount the VCD (an entry
>of `auto' is given in my fstab for cdrom) then try to read the file
>avseq01.dat from the /mnt/cdrom/mpegav/avseq01.dat. Is there a solution?
>
mplayer is pretty good, I use xine (gooogle to find it). it salso good, 
full screen, skins and all functions you'll require of a player, its got 
a neat feature of a VCD/DVD button that start up the VCD without needing 
a file search.
the best thing would be to download both xine and mplayer and try both out.
